mqueue: correct the type of ro to int

The ro variable, being of type bool, caused the -EROFS return value from
mnt_want_write() to be implicitly converted to 1. This prevented the file
from being correctly acquired, thus triggering the issue reported by
syzbot [1].

Changing the type of ro to int allows the system to correctly identify
the reason for the file open failure.
